|
|
A Novel Ant Colony Algorithm Based on Time Model |
ZUO HongHao1,2, XIONG FanLun1 |
1.Institute of Intelligent Machines, Chinese Academy of Sciences, Hefei 230031 2.Department of Automation, University of Science and Technology of China, Hefei 230027 |
|
|
Abstract Basic ant colony algorithm, which is based on bionics, has been successfully used in many fields, especially on combinatorial optimization problems. Because many parameters need to be adjusted in application, it is inconvenient for many users especially those who have little experience. A novel ant colony algorithm based on real time model, which regresses to the base of ant colony algorithm is put forward. It is supposed that each ant’s velocity is equal to dmin per second and all ants are crawling in full time. Ants communicate with others by the pheromone that is left on the road. After some time the ants’ trails will be on the optimal route between the food and the nest. It is testified by the experiment that the novel algorithm is as efficient as other ant colony algorithms and it is simpler to justify the parameters. This novel algorithm also can be used in simulating application and distributed computing.
|
Received: 12 July 2004
|
|
|
|
|
[1] Colorni A, Dorigo M, Maniezzo V. Distributed Optimization by Ant Colonies. In: Proc of the 1st European Conference on Artificial Life. Paris, France, 1992, 134-142 [2] Dorigo M, Maniezzo V, Colorni A. The Ant System: Optimization by a Colony of Cooperating Agents. IEEE Trans on Systems, Man, and Cybernetics, 1996, 26(1): 29-41 [3] Dorigo M, Gambardella L M. Ant Colonies for the Traveling Salesman Problem. BioSystems, 1997, 43(2): 73-81 [4] Dorigo M, Gambardella L M. Ant Colony System: A Cooperative Learning Approach to the Traveling Salesman Problem. IEEE Trans on Evolutionary Computation, 1997, 1(1): 53-66 [5] Sun T, Wang X K, Liu Y X, et al. Ant Algorithm and Analysis on Its Convergence. Mini-Micro Systems, 2003, 24(8): 1524-1527 (in Chinese) (孙 焘,王秀坤,刘业欣,等.一种简单蚂蚁算法及其收敛性分析.小型微型计算机系统, 2003, 24(8): 1524-1527) [6] Jin P, Fan J B, Tan Y D. Neural Network and Neural Computer. Chengdu, China: Southwest Jiaotong University Press, 1991, 375-377 (in Chinese) (靳 藩,范俊波,谭永东.神经网络与神经计算机.成都:西南交通大学出版社,1991, 375-377) [7] Jin P. Basic of Neural Computational Intelligence. Chengdu, China: Southwest Jiaotong University Press, 2000, 300-308 (in Chinese) (靳 藩.神经计算智能基础.成都:西南交通大学出版社,2000, 300-308) [8] Kang L S, Xie Y, You S Y, et al. Non-Numerical Parallel Algorithm-Simulated Annealing Algorithm. Beijing, China: Science Press, 1994, 150-151 (in Chinese) (康立山,谢 云,尤矢勇,等.非数值并行算法——模拟退火算法.北京:科学出版社, 1994, 150-151) [9] Website. http://www.iwr.uni-heidelberg.de/groups/comopt/software/TSPLIB95/tsp/ [10]Website. http://www.iwr.uni-heidelberg.de/groups/comopt/software/TSPLIB95/TSPFAQ.html |
|
|
|